Advocates See TSCA Bill's Safety Threshold Upending EPA Cancer Analyses

Environmentalists are concerned that language in the bipartisan Senate bill reforming the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A) could overturn the agency's strict policy for assessing chemicals' cancer risks, which assumes that some chemicals have no safe exposure level and subjects them to conservative risk assessment methods and regulatory limits. The advocates are concerned over language that requires EPA to consider whether chemicals have a safe exposure threshold below which harm does not occur. One source says it is "scientifically impossible" to prove that a chemical does not have a threshold, so language in the bill requiring EPA to consider whether a substance has a threshold is a major win for industry because it would allow them to pressure EPA to use less-conservative assessment methods. "Regulation of a [linear-assessed] carcinogen imposes much stricter limits than the assumption of a threshold," the source says.
